Overview of the Goethe Certificate C1
The Goethe Certificate C1 is aligned with Level C1 of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). At this level, candidates are expected to have a detailed understanding of the German language, allowing them to interact efficiently in a vast array of contexts. This consists of the ability to express complex concepts, comprehend comprehensive and nuanced texts, and take part in advanced conversations.

Structure of the Examination
The Goethe Certificate C1 assessment is divided into 4 main areas, each developed to test different aspects of language proficiency:
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)
- Format: Candidates check out a range of texts, including short articles, essays, and literary excerpts.
- Tasks: Multiple-choice concerns, gap-filling exercises, and short-answer questions.
- Period: 60 minutes.
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)
- Format: Candidates listen to recordings of conversations, interviews, and public statements.
- Jobs: Multiple-choice questions, true/false statements, and gap-filling exercises.
- Duration: 40 minutes.
Composing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)
- Format: Candidates write an essay or a letter on a provided topic.
- Tasks: One writing job that requires making use of complex language structures and a vast array of vocabulary.
- Duration: 60 minutes.
Speaking (Mündlicher Ausdruck)
- Format: Candidates participate in a conversation with an inspector and another prospect.
- Jobs: Discussion of an offered topic, role-plays, and expressing opinions.
- Period: 15 minutes per candidate.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: What is the expense of the Goethe Certificate C1 examination?
- The expense differs depending upon the country and the test center. It normally ranges from EUR150 to EUR250. Inspect the Goethe-Institut website for the most precise and up-to-date info.
Q: How long does it require to receive the outcomes?
- Outcomes are typically offered within four weeks after the evaluation. Prospects can examine their results online through the Goethe-Institut's website.
Q: Can I retake the examination if I do not pass?
- Yes, you can retake the evaluation. However, there is a waiting duration of three months between efforts.
Q: Is the Goethe Certificate C1 acknowledged worldwide?
- Yes, the Goethe Certificate C1 is worldwide acknowledged and is highly valued by universities, companies, and language organizations worldwide.
Q: What is the difference between the Goethe Certificate C1 and the Goethe Certificate C2 (Recommended Browsing)?
- The Goethe Certificate C2 is the greatest level of accreditation provided by the Goethe-Institut. It represents near-native proficiency in German. The C1 level, while advanced, is an action listed below C2 and is enough for the majority of scholastic and professional purposes.
